I was at Conneaut for several hours today until I could not take the dogs and people on the spit any longer

I saw 11 species of shorebirds

I was told prior to my arrival there was a Baird`s Sandpiper and 2 Ruddy Turnstones here that I did not see

Here are some of the birds seen while I was here


1 Stilt Sandpiper

2 Short-billed Dowitcher

6 Sanderling

2 Lesser Yellowlegs

1 Wilson`s Snipe

22 Semi-palmated Sandpiper

9 Least Sandpiper

1 Black-bellied Plover

18 Semi-palmated Plover

1 A. Golden Plover

13 Killdeer

2 Sora

2 Blue-winged Teal

1 Green-winged Teal

4 Great Egret

10 Caspian Tern

1 Common Tern

7 Bonaparte`s Gull

2 Great Black-backed Gull

2 Bald Eagle
